Guitar Hero Live Gets New Songs, Concert Footage, and All-Access Weekend

Guitar Hero Live is getting new songs and concert footage alongside an all-access weekend for Guitar Hero TV.  Starting today, Freestyle Games will start rolling out the promised free content for the game in the form of new playable songs and shows in Guitar Hero TV.  Starting on Friday November 6th at 4am PT, Guitar Hero Live players will be able to access all songs, free on-demand access to the entire Guitar Hero TV catalog for the entire weekend.

Guitar Hero Live will introduce content from the Black Veil Brides in the form of a Premium Show.  This includes footage from one of the band’s Black Mass Tour, and will include the songs: Heart of Fire, Fallen Angels, and In the End.  Other Premium Shows include Paramore, Fall Out Boy, Blink-182, The 1975, American Authors, and George Ezra.

Going forward with Guitar Hero Live, Activision says that new concert footage and music videos will be added to Guitar Hero TV from Weezer, Judas Priest, Alice in Chains, System of a Down, and more.  This new content will arrive on Guitar Hero Live in the form of Premium Shows, which can be accessed by completing in-game challenges to unlock.
